Predictive role of ABC transporters in the efficacy of enfortumab vedotin for urothelial carcinoma
Abstract Objective To evaluate the correlation between ATP‐binding cassette (ABC) transporter expression and therapeutic efficacy of enfortumab vedotin (EV), an antibody‐drug conjugate targeting Nectin‐4, in urothelial cancer, as only a few studies have been conducted on this topic.
